Review:

Anki (flashcard App)

overall review score: 4.5
score is between 0 and 5
Anki is a popular, open-source flashcard application designed to facilitate efficient memorization and long-term learning through spaced repetition. It allows users to create, download, and study digital flashcards on various topics, supporting customization and multimedia integration for enhanced learning experiences.

Key Features

  • Spaced repetition algorithm to optimize memory retention
  • Cross-platform support (Windows, macOS, Linux, iOS, Android)
  • Customizable flashcards with images, audio, and videos
  • Ability to share and download pre-made decks
  • Open-source with extensive community contributions
  • Synchronizes data across devices via AnkiWeb

Pros

  • Highly effective for long-term memorization and retaining complex information
  • Flexible customization options for personalized learning
  • Free and open-source software with active community support
  • Supports multimedia content to enhance engagement
  • Cross-platform compatibility allows seamless studying on various devices

Cons

  • Steep learning curve for new users unfamiliar with spaced repetition systems
  • Interface can be perceived as outdated or less user-friendly compared to modern apps
  • Occasional syncing issues or technical glitches
  • Creating richly detailed decks may require significant initial effort
